In a game that mirrored how the Baylor season has gone in many ways, the Bears couldn't climb out of an early hole in a loss to Houston in the final game of the regular season Saturday at McLane Stadium. Baylor has missed a bowl game in three of six seasons under head coach Dave Aranda, while it has had four losing seasons in that span. Trib sports editor Brice Cherry and Baylor beat writer Zach Smith break down the loss to the Cougars and discuss what comes next for the Bears.
